** AstraZeneca is seeking a Senior Specialist in Computational Pathology Delivery Operations in Munich, Germany. The role focuses on executing computational pathology workflows, managing large-scale imaging datasets, and ensuring data quality for AI/ML model development and biomarker discovery. **

Job Summary

  • This role is responsible for ensuring the reliable execution of computational pathology workflows, including data ingestion, curation, quality control, and analysis activities.
  • The position plays a key role in ensuring that imaging data, metadata, annotations, and analysis outputs are fit for purpose for AI development, scientific decision-making, and potential regulatory applications.

Key Requirements

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in data science, bioinformatics, biomedical informatics, biomedical engineering, or a related field
  • Experience in data management within healthcare, diagnostics, or life sciences
  • Fluency with FAIR data principles
  • Experience with large-scale imaging datasets
  • Experience with dataset versioning, reproducible data preparation workflows, and quality control processes
  • Working knowledge of Python or similar scripting languages
